Kim Kardashian and Kris Humphries reach divorce settlement

LOS ANGELES — The clock will finally run out on Kim Kardashian’s marriage!

Lawyers for the reality TV star and Nets forward Kris Humphries told an LA judge today they’ve settled their highly publicized divorce case.

LA Superior Court Judge Scott Gordon is expected to formally sign off on the deal in June.

Today’s minutes-long hearing, announcing the deal, belied the bitter, months-long case that’s held up Kardashian’s possible union with current boyfriend and hip-hop icon Kanye West.

No terms of the settlement were immediately available.

Gordon thanked both sides for coming to a deal, hashed out after a recent, marathon three-hour meeting.

Kardashian was in attendance at today’s hearing but Humphries was not. He was represented in court by his lawyer.

Gordon told both sides he hopes they lead happy lives.

Kardashian, 32, and Humphries, 28, tied the knot on Aug. 20, 2011, near Santa Barbara, in a highly profitable, made-for-TV event.

Their marital bliss lasted 72 days. Kardashian filed for divorce, citing the boilerplate “irreconcilable differences.”

The curvy reality TV star denied the wedding was nothing more than a big-money publicity stunt.

Humphries, at the Nets facility in East Rutherford, NJ, declined to speak directly about his divorce.

But the 6-foot-9 forward did say divorce talks weren’t a distraction.

“I would never let something get in the way of basketball,” he said.

“Basketball is always my focus. I would never let anything get in the way of basketball, the playoffs or ever miss a game.”

The Nets open the playoffs tomorrow night, in Brooklyn, against the Chicago Bulls.
